Cawthron provides research based solutions to enable the sustainable management and development of New Zealand's coastal and freshwater systems and resources for the benefit of the region and the nation. It is New Zealand's largest, independent, community-owned research centre, with over 180 scientific and technical staff based in Nelson and Marlborough. We undertake research and development at its aquaculture facility; and focus on wealth creation through aquaculture with a strong focus on shellfish. We are recognised as a New Zealand and world leader in the protection and restoration of coastal and freshwater ecosystems. We also provide practical science and technology solutions to enable the sustainable management and development of New Zealand's natural resources.
